Please note that this role is not suitable for current students. This role is a part time position working approx 16hrs per week, 32 weeks per annum. We are happy to discuss flexibility with the hours with this role.
Our Campus is a vibrant and exciting place in the centre of Southend with students studying a variety of subjects. We are there to support students with their degree, through representation, advice, putting on great events and delivering excellent services. The Lounge is an important space for students to grab a hot drink or attend our events.
As the Venue Supervisor of the Lounge you will be responsible overseeing all aspects of the day to day operation, ensuring excellent customer service is delivered at all times. Your role will include recruiting, training, developing, and monitoring the progress of the Venues Assistants.
